The Alliant Government-Wide Acquisition Contract (GWAC) is a premier IT contract vehicle managed by the General Services Administration (GSA). Alliant allows federal agencies to procure cutting-edge IT solutions through a streamlined process. It is a multiple-award, indefinite-delivery/indefinite-quantity (IDIQ) contract that gives businesses access to government contracts worth billions of dollars. The Alliant 3 SB GWAC is a contract vehicle managed by the General Services Administration (GSA). It is specifically designed to provide small businesses with opportunities to deliver information technology (IT) solutions to the federal government. This contract is a successor to Alliant 2 SB, building on its strengths and addressing new government IT requirements.
